Cardiff Bus service 23 - Pantmawr Road Closure.

Tuesday 29th August 2017 for 12 weeks

Due to the continuing gas mains replacement work in Rhiwbina, Pantmawr Road will be closed in an easterly direction from the A470 junction to the junction with Rhiwbina Hill from Tuesday 29th August for 12 weeks. This is an eastbound one-way closure affecting service 23 only, the westbound direction and service 21 are not affected.

During this time service 23 will divert and a shuttle bus will operate as follows:

Service 23 Diversion
Buses will operate normal route through Whitchurch Village and along the western part of Pantmawr Road. Then at the junction of Pantmawr Road and the A470, they will turn right along the A470, then left into Ty’n-Y-Parc Road, then right into Pantbach Road and return to normal route.

Shuttle Bus
As service 23 will be unable to serve the eastern section of Pantmawr Road, Rhiwbina Hill, Wenallt Road, Heol Uchaf, Heol Llanishen Fach or Rhiwbina Village we will operate a circular shuttle bus that will run each day from Wenallt Road (The Deri) to Birchgrove via Wenallt Road, Heol Uchaf, Heol Llanishen Fach and Panbtbach Road, and return from Birchgrove to Wenallt Road direct via Pantbach Road. Customers can connect at Birchgrove either onto the diverted 23 service or the 27 for onward travel along North Road to the city centre.

Alternatively, customers in Heol Llanishen Fach, Heol Uchaf, Wenallt Road and Pantmawr Road can use service 21 for journeys to the city centre via Whitchurch avoiding the need to change buses.
